MSc International Business and Management – London

  • DeadlineStudy Details: 15 months

Masters Degree Description

Develop your understanding of business and management and apply your studies in an international context.

Studying in London, you'll gain a comprehensive understanding of international business and management issues as you explore topics including corporate strategy, financial management, international business and global sustainability.

You'll consider these subjects globally and graduate from this MSc International Business and Management Masters' ready to boost your career in business, whether you want to work in the UK or overseas.

Entry Requirements

  • A second-class honours degree or equivalent professional experience and/or qualifications.
  • English language proficiency at a minimum of IELTS band 6.5 with no component score below 5.5.

Module Details

Core modules

  • Corporate Strategy - 15 credits
  • Global Sustainability - 15 credits
  • Management Development - 15 credits
  • Operations Management - 15 credits
  • Financial Management - 15 credits
  • Human Resource Management - 15 credits
  • Independent Study Project - 30 credits
  • Innovation Management - 15 credits
  • International Marketing - 15 credits
  • Research Methods - 15 credits
  • International Business - 15 credits
